Formed in 1720 from Essex, King and Queen, and King William, and named for Alexander Spotswood, Governor of Virginia, 1710-1722. The Battles of Fredericksburg, Chancellorsville, the Wilderness (partly) and Spotsylvania were fought in this county.
Conservation and Development Commission, 1934
